Water resources include three ponds, flood irrigation, handlines, two Nelson guns, and a water right from Seiad Creek. The irrigated acreage supports grass hay and pasture, while the ranch operation runs approximately 25 pair year-round and raises 90–100 meat goat kids. The property has Klamath River frontage, a paved-road setting, and high-speed fiber-optic internet available. Outdoor recreation in the surrounding area includes hiking, hunting, fishing, bird watching, and riding, with Marble Mountain Wilderness and Klamath National Forest nearby. Seiad Valley provides a store, cafe, post office, fuel, RV park, and elementary school; the ranch is approximately 15 miles south of the Oregon border, about 20 minutes from Happy Camp, and roughly an hour from Yreka.
